Ernest Hilbert’s All of You on the Good Earth Breathes New Life into the Sonnet

Glassworks reviewed Ernest Hilbert's latest poetry collection, All of You on the Good Earth, praising its use of perspective and observation to reflect on past and modern humanity.

Writer Stephanie M. Kohler says, "A denizen of the present and an admirer of the past, Hilbert is human: he is an observer. He doesn’t overlook the not so pristine images of industrialism or modernity, but he also does not herald the great histories. Instead, he delves into both, mixing old and new, reaching for truth as he sees it, using one of the most classical literary forms, each sonnet a small window looking out to the larger view."
